Gladia Secures $16 Million to Transform Audio Transcription

Gladia Boosts Multilingual Audio Services with New Funding
Gladia, an innovative player in AI transcription and audio intelligence, has successfully completed a Series A funding round amounting to USD 16 million. This fresh influx of capital will enable Gladia to propel its evolution from a mere speech-to-text API developer into a comprehensive audio infrastructure provider. Targeted use cases for this expanded service include agent assistance in contact centers, enhancing sales tools, and powering AI meeting assistants.
Advancing Real-Time Transcription Technology
With the new funding, Gladia aims to enhance its real-time audio transcription and analytics engine. This advanced technology will provide voice-first platforms with the ability to deliver superior functionality for users operating across multiple languages and locales, leveraging state-of-the-art AI.
A Supportive Network of Investors
The Series A funding round was spearheaded by XAnge, with a diverse range of other significant investors joining the effort. Notable contributions came from Illuminate Financial, XTX Ventures, and several others, culminating in a total funding of USD 20.3 million for Gladia since its inception in 2022. This strong financial support is aimed at fostering the company’s innovative vision and the expansion of its services.
Breaking Language Barriers in Communication
The ability to accurately transcribe spoken content in real time across various accents and languages is rare in the industry. Gladia’s unique approach directly addresses this gap, offering advanced transcription capabilities in over 100 languages. This is especially crucial for international teams whose members frequently switch languages during discussions, ensuring that nuances and meaning are preserved.
Feature of Enhanced Insights
Beyond basic transcription, Gladia's technology captures critical insights from conversations—like sentiment, key points, and overall summaries—efficiently generating these analyses in under a second. This feature can significantly boost the productivity of teams, allowing for more actionable outcomes from meetings or calls.
Real-Time Challenges Overcome
Creating a multilingual, low-latency transcription engine requires considerable resources and expertise. Gladia has succeeded in overcoming the hurdles traditionally associated with real-time transcription by achieving an impressive latency of under 300 milliseconds, allowing companies to integrate this technology seamlessly into their existing systems.
Aiming for Future Innovations in AI
As Gladia makes strides with its audio intelligence products, the company plans to develop a comprehensive toolkit that includes various advanced AI functionalities. This innovation promises to meet the growing demand for sophisticated audio processing tools, particularly for sectors like sales and customer service, where timely and accurate communication is paramount.
The Journey of the Founders
The vision for Gladia emerged from CEO Jean-Louis Quéguiner’s personal experiences with inadequate audio transcription services that struggled with his accent. His ambition is to build a service that not only tackles language barriers but also enhances overall communication efficiency for businesses worldwide.
About Gladia
Founded in 2022 by Jean-Louis Quéguiner and Jonathan Soto, Gladia is on a mission to harness advanced AI technologies to provide actionable insights from audio data. The company is based in Paris and serves an impressive clientele of over 600 enterprise customers, demonstrating the effectiveness and reliability of its services.
